From: Early life exposure to nicotine modifies lung gene response after elastase-induced emphysema

Fig. 4

Comparison between elastase and saline instillation in control and nicotine-pretreated mice at ped3. RNAseq analysis, with significance higher than 0.05 and fold changes (FC) of 2 or higher between the elastase and saline treated lungs resulted in 839 (723 upregulated + 116 downregulated) differentially expressed genes in the control group (A left) and 516 (439 upregulated + 77 downregulated) differentially expressed genes in the nicotine group (A right). Top 10 pathways modified by upregulated genes are shown in B for the control and in C for the nicotine group. The common pathways between B and C are shown in green. Top 10 pathways (or less) modified by downregulated genes are shown in D for the control and in E for the nicotine group. Only pathways with -log(pValue) of 3 or more are shown
